Looking for ideas to engage your students in conversation? In this week's quick news roundup, I give you stories about:

  • The impact of overwork on the teacher's brain,
  • An idea for an energy drink experiment for science teachers around the chemical "taurine"
  • NASA and the tectonic plates of Venus
  • YouTube's new "Peak Points" Advertising strategy as an AI article to discuss with students
  • ChatGPT 4 going away? And how I teach students to test different models of AI and share their results
  • How some people are installing local LLM's on their machines
  • New AI guidance for teachers and common patterns I'm noting
  • Google's AIME and the future of medical chat bots
  • DuoLingo goes AI, and
  • A Star-Wars themed personality test gone to the dark side?

Once a week, I work to share news articles and stories with you that I'm using. I want you to have quick ideas for turning headlines into a warm-up, debate, or story starter.
